Construction and Appearance. Crafted from billet 6061-T6 aircraft grade aluminum, this hitch recovery point boasts a matte blue finish for standout style and corrosion resistance. It weighs just 1.13 pounds, but is engineered with a certified minimum braking strength of 49,150 pounds and a maximum working load of 15,000 pounds for confidence in extreme conditions. The design features a 1-inch diameter by 2-inch-long shackle eyelet that does not require an attached D-ring, simplifying setup and use. Made in America, it is intended for use with a standard 5/8-inch hitch pin (not included).
Installation. As a direct replacement, the Hitch Recovery Point installs quickly in most standard receivers without modifications. Its single-piece design ensures easy installation for both off-road enthusiasts and those new to recovery gear, requiring only a standard hitch pin for secure attachment.
